PLMFTs are required to remain under the active supervision of their Board-Approved LMFT-S while they are providing mental health counseling and marriage and family therapy services until they are independently licensed as an LMFT. These examsdo not have to be taken prior to PLPC application, but either exam must be attempted at least once per PLPC renewal period until a passing score is achieved. Of the 40 CEUs submitted, at least 20 hours must be in the area of marriage and family therapy with an emphasis upon systemic approaches or the theory, research, or practice of systemic psychotherapeutic work with couples or families including three hours of ethics specific to marriage and family therapy. You must have completed a minimum of 3,000 supervision hours, remained under active Board-approved supervision for at least 24 months, and have passed the NCE or NCMHCE exam in order to apply for LPC licensure.
